a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Szczepan Zalega <szczepan@nitrokey.com>2019-06-25 09:21:16 +0200
committerSzczepan Zalega <szczepan@nitrokey.com>2019-06-25 09:21:16 +0200
commit0cf995e79221fa2e88801fb910eba8aacf54d58a (patch)
tree06f27a1a65f9a43b6cfba9a5e5fffdb4ae3b9e72
parentb1b851658ab720462f0c5b46d9cc7661be6cf493 (diff)
downloadlibnitrokey-0cf995e79221fa2e88801fb910eba8aacf54d58a.tar.gz
libnitrokey-0cf995e79221fa2e88801fb910eba8aacf54d58a.tar.bz2
Add numbers to generated OTP slot namesHEADmaster
Signed-off-by: Szczepan Zalega <szczepan@nitrokey.com>
-rw-r--r--unittest/test_pro.py6
1 files changed, 4 insertions, 2 deletions
diff --git a/unittest/test_pro.py b/unittest/test_pro.py
index 5162365..a8df7cd 100644
--- a/unittest/test_pro.py
+++ b/unittest/test_pro.py
@@ -434,7 +434,8 @@ def test_HOTP_64bit_counter(C):
def helper_set_HOTP_test_slot(C, slot_number):
assert C.NK_first_authenticate(DefaultPasswords.ADMIN, DefaultPasswords.ADMIN_TEMP) == DeviceErrorCode.STATUS_OK
- assert C.NK_write_hotp_slot(slot_number, b'python_test', bbRFC_SECRET, 0, False, False, True, b'', DefaultPasswords.ADMIN_TEMP) == DeviceErrorCode.STATUS_OK
+ slot_name = b'HOTP_test'[:-2] + '{:02}'.format(slot_number).encode()
+ assert C.NK_write_hotp_slot(slot_number, slot_name, bbRFC_SECRET, 0, False, False, True, b'', DefaultPasswords.ADMIN_TEMP) == DeviceErrorCode.STATUS_OK
def helper_set_TOTP_test_slot(C, slot_number):
@@ -443,7 +444,8 @@ def helper_set_TOTP_test_slot(C, slot_number):
assert C.NK_write_config(255, 255, 255, PIN_protection, not PIN_protection,
DefaultPasswords.ADMIN_TEMP) == DeviceErrorCode.STATUS_OK
assert C.NK_first_authenticate(DefaultPasswords.ADMIN, DefaultPasswords.ADMIN_TEMP) == DeviceErrorCode.STATUS_OK
- assert C.NK_write_totp_slot(slot_number, b'python_test', bbRFC_SECRET, 30, False, False, False, b'',
+ slot_name = b'TOTP_test'[:-2] + '{:02}'.format(slot_number).encode()
+ assert C.NK_write_totp_slot(slot_number, slot_name, bbRFC_SECRET, 30, False, False, False, b'',
DefaultPasswords.ADMIN_TEMP) == DeviceErrorCode.STATUS_OK